Master of Indigenous Business Leadership
The William Cooper Institute and the Monash Business School jointly offer a new Master of Indigenous Business Leadership – a transformational leadership program for Indigenous Australians designed to strengthen Australia’s Indigenous workforce in public, private and community sectors. The program is Australia’s first Indigenous-led business master’s program, co-designed by Indigenous business leaders, Elders and business school academics to directly address the diversity gap in senior-level corporate Australia.
The Master of Indigenous Business Leadership is a cross-disciplinary program with leading units delivered through the Faculty of Business, complemented by a tailored offering in design thinking and mastery units from Law, Public Health and Public Policy. Senior Lecturer Katrina Mohamed and her team were awarded the Australian Business Deans Council Award for Innovation and Excellence in Learning and Teaching in 2022, recognising the excellence of this masters program.
